What Is This Restorative Procedure?

A hair transplant is a surgical technique that moves individual hair follicles from a donor site—usually the back or sides of the scalp—to areas experiencing thinning or baldness. These donor follicles are genetically resistant to the hormone dihydrotestosterone (DHT), which is the primary driver of pattern hair loss. By relocating these resilient grafts, surgeons can create sustainable growth in areas where hair has previously ceased to develop.

How This Treatment Mechanism Works

The mechanism of action relies on the physiological stability of the donor hair. During the procedure, specialized instruments are used to extract follicular units. Once harvested, these units are meticulously implanted into micro-incisions made in the recipient area. The success of the procedure depends heavily on the surgeon's ability to match the natural angle, depth, and direction of the patient’s existing hair, ensuring the results appear seamless and indistinguishable from natural growth.

Why This Intervention Is Used

The primary purpose of undergoing this surgery is to address permanent hair loss, such as androgenetic alopecia. Unlike temporary topical solutions or shampoos, which only provide cosmetic camouflage, this procedure offers a permanent structural change. It is designed to provide long-term density for individuals who have exhausted non-surgical options but still have viable donor areas on their scalp.

Hair Transplant in Dubai Recovery Timeline

Healing typically follows a predictable course. Patients may experience minor swelling or redness for the first few days. By weeks two to four, the transplanted hair shafts often shed; this is a normal part of the process, as the follicles enter a temporary resting phase. Real, visible regrowth typically begins around the four-month mark, with full maturity of the transplanted hair occurring between 12 and 18 months.
